2010-12-29 8 views
1

Open LDAPからの認証を使用してasp.netで開発されたいくつかのアプリケーションがあります。アプリケーションは正常に動作しており、認証に問題はありません。ASP.NET、オープンLDAPロールベースのセキュリティ

主な問題は、ユーザーの役割と責任を管理することであると要件はかなり頻繁に変更します。いずれかが利用者の役割とユーザーロールを管理するための任意の他の方法を管理するためのオープンソースのフレームワークを提案することができ、すなわち、オープンLDAP内等...

私は、Visualガードのようないくつかの商用ソリューションを検討してきたが、オープンソースを探しています。

+0

サクビブ、これはコーディング自体よりもプロセスとプラクティスの問題のほうが聞こえます。 http://serverfault.comでこの問題をほぼ確実に遭遇するStackoverflowに相当するサーバー管理の上でこれ以上の質問をするのが良いでしょう。 – stephbu

答えて

1

あなたは、ディレクトリに対してクエリを実行するためにNovell's LDAP library for C#を使用してcustom Role providerを実装することができます。

LDAP groupsは、役割のバッキングストアとして使用することができます。

+0

My Open LDAPは現在、多くのアプリケーションで使用されており、すべてのアプリケーション(ロール用)のユーザーグループを作成するのは非常に困難です。 – Saqib

+0

カスタムプロバイダでLDAPグループを使用する必要はありません。プレーン/ XMLファイルまたはデータベースは使いやすいです。次の質問を確認してください:http://stackoverflow.com/questions/2728976/asp-net-custom-role-management http://stackoverflow.com/questions/3760871/sample-c-code-to-manage-roles-with -roles-provider –

関連する問題